Bucharest, the capital city of Romania, is an intriguing blend of old-world charm and modern energy. Known for its eclectic architecture, the city presents a fascinating tapestry of influences, from neoclassical and Art Deco to communist-era buildings and contemporary designs. This architectural diversity is a testament to the city's complex history and its ability to adapt and transform. Bucharest's streets are alive with cafes, parks, and a vibrant arts scene, offering a unique perspective on Romanian culture. The city's extensive green spaces provide a breath of fresh air, inviting both locals and visitors to unwind amidst nature.
